What is the Confidence Code? ๐Ÿค”

The Confidence Code isn't a secret formula; it's a combination of mindset, behavior, and self-perception. Itโ€™s about believing in yourself, understanding your value, and projecting that belief outward. When you exude confidence, people are naturally drawn to you. This concept is crucial for understanding how to radiate popularity, as confidence is often the foundational piece. It is your inner light that shines and draws others in.

The Inner Game: Self-Belief

Confidence starts from within. You need to cultivate a strong sense of self-belief. This means recognizing your strengths, accepting your weaknesses, and focusing on your accomplishments. Avoid negative self-talk and replace it with positive affirmations. Practice self-compassion and remind yourself that everyone makes mistakes. It's how you handle those mistakes that truly defines you.

The Outer Game: Action & Behavior

Confidence is also about taking action. Stepping outside your comfort zone and facing your fears head-on. The more you do this, the more confident you become. Start with small steps and gradually increase the challenge. Celebrate your successes, no matter how small. Each success builds momentum and fuels your confidence.

๐Ÿ’ช Building Your Self-Esteem: Practical Techniques

Self-esteem is the bedrock of confidence. It's your overall sense of self-worth and value. Here are some practical techniques to boost your self-esteem and, in turn, amplify your popularity potential:

Positive Self-Talk

Challenge negative thoughts and replace them with positive ones. Create a list of affirmations and repeat them daily. For example, instead of thinking "I'm not good enough," try "I am capable and worthy of success." Remember, your thoughts shape your reality.

Set Achievable Goals

Break down large goals into smaller, manageable steps. This allows you to experience frequent successes, which builds your confidence. Celebrate each milestone and acknowledge your progress.

Practice Self-Care

Take care of your physical and mental well-being. This includes eating healthy, exercising regularly, getting enough sleep, and engaging in activities you enjoy. When you feel good, you naturally exude more confidence.

Focus on Your Strengths

Identify your talents and skills and find ways to use them. When you focus on what you're good at, you feel more confident and capable. Don't dwell on your weaknesses; instead, work on improving them gradually.

๐Ÿ—ฃ๏ธ The Body Language of Confidence: Nonverbal Cues

Nonverbal communication plays a crucial role in projecting confidence. Your body language speaks volumes, even before you utter a single word. Master these nonverbal cues to enhance your popularity potential:

Maintain Eye Contact

Looking someone in the eye shows that you're engaged, interested, and confident. Avoid darting your eyes around or looking down. A steady gaze conveys sincerity and trustworthiness.

Stand Tall and Maintain Good Posture

Stand up straight with your shoulders back and your head held high. Good posture projects confidence and authority. Avoid slouching, which can make you appear insecure and disengaged.

Use Open and Welcoming Gestures

Uncross your arms and legs and use open hand gestures. This signals that you're approachable and receptive to others. Avoid fidgeting or crossing your arms, which can make you appear defensive or closed off.

Smile Authentically

A genuine smile can light up your face and make you appear more friendly and approachable. Smile with your eyes, not just your mouth. A forced smile can come across as insincere.

Project a Strong Voice

Speak clearly and confidently, using a strong and steady voice. Avoid mumbling or speaking too softly. Vary your tone and pace to keep your listeners engaged.

๐Ÿšซ Confidence Blockers: Identify and Overcome

Many factors can undermine your confidence and prevent you from radiating popularity. Identify these "confidence blockers" and develop strategies to overcome them:

Fear of Failure

The fear of making mistakes can paralyze you and prevent you from taking risks. Reframe failure as a learning opportunity and embrace the idea that mistakes are a natural part of growth. Don't be afraid to try new things, even if you're not sure you'll succeed.

Negative Self-Talk

Self-criticism can erode your self-esteem and undermine your confidence. Challenge negative thoughts and replace them with positive affirmations. Focus on your strengths and accomplishments, rather than dwelling on your weaknesses and failures.

Comparison to Others

Comparing yourself to others can lead to feelings of inadequacy and insecurity. Remember that everyone is on their own unique journey. Focus on your own progress and celebrate your own successes. Avoid social media traps, which can often present unrealistic and unattainable standards.

Perfectionism

The pursuit of perfection can lead to anxiety and stress. Accept that you're not perfect and that it's okay to make mistakes. Focus on progress, not perfection. Remember, done is better than perfect.

๐Ÿค Building Genuine Connections: The Key to Lasting Popularity

True popularity isn't about superficial popularity; it's about building genuine connections with others. When you exude authentic confidence, people are naturally drawn to you. Be yourself, be genuine, and be interested in others. Connect on a deeper level and build meaningful relationships. Being authentic is key.

Active Listening

Pay attention to what others are saying and show that you're genuinely interested. Ask questions, make eye contact, and nod your head to show that you're engaged. Avoid interrupting or thinking about what you're going to say next.

Empathy and Understanding

Put yourself in other people's shoes and try to understand their perspectives. Show compassion and offer support when they're going through difficult times. Empathy builds trust and strengthens relationships.

Authenticity and Vulnerability

Be yourself and don't be afraid to show your vulnerability. Share your thoughts and feelings honestly and authentically. Authenticity builds trust and allows others to connect with you on a deeper level.

Kindness and Generosity

Treat others with kindness and generosity. Offer help and support whenever you can. Small acts of kindness can make a big difference in someone's life. Radiate kindness, and it will return to you.

๐Ÿ“Š Mental Health Considerations for Confidence

It's important to recognize the relationship between confidence and mental well-being. Overconfidence can sometimes mask insecurities, and a lack of confidence can stem from underlying mental health challenges. It's essential to:

  • Seek professional help if you're struggling with anxiety, depression, or other mental health issues.
  • Practice self-compassion and be kind to yourself.
  • Set realistic expectations and avoid striving for perfection.
  • Build a supportive network of friends and family.

Table: Symptoms vs. Strategies

Symptom Strategy
Constant self-doubt Practice positive self-talk
Avoidance of social situations Start with small, manageable interactions
Overthinking and anxiety Mindfulness and meditation techniques

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How long does it take to build confidence?
A: Building confidence is a journey, not a destination. It takes time, effort, and consistent practice. Be patient with yourself and celebrate your progress along the way.
Q: What if I'm naturally introverted? Can I still be popular?

Q: How do I deal with rejection or criticism?
A: Rejection and criticism are inevitable parts of life. Don't take them personally. Learn from your mistakes and use them as opportunities for growth. Surround yourself with supportive people who believe in you.
Q: Is there a dark side to popularity?
A: Yes, there can be. Popularity can sometimes lead to pressure to conform, fear of losing status, and superficial relationships. It's important to stay true to yourself and maintain your values, even when you're popular.
